Sony Ericsson identifies second life for old phones
Company reveals mobile phone components are already being used in medical equipment, consumer goods and childrens' toys. Sony Ericsson has revealed that it is likely to expand an innovative recycling scheme to reuse many of the components from its old phones in medical equipment, consumer goods and even toys. Apart from these, some of the elemental terms you need to know before you attempt flashing are-

Main- Main Firmware. The OS (Operating System like Windows) of your phone. But its unchangeable.

FS stands for File System. Like Your Windows drivers, the phones too have drivers to manage the hardware functionalities. And FS contains drivers like sound, camera etc alongwith files such as images, menus.

That brings us to Flash Menus. We are sure you have come across downloadable files claiming to be Flash Menus (.swf extension) Well, precisely, merely setting such themes won’t make them work. You will have to manually edit the menus or replace them with such “Flash Menus” in order to get them as they are claimed.

Next in line is CDA or CustPack. gives you a list of allowed languages etc. Your phone will malfunction if you forget to put this gentleman inside the system!!
